RESIDENT CAMPING PROGRAMS

Camp Ta Ta Pochon is located in the San Bernadino National, just 15 miles "up the hill" from Redlands, California -- about 90 minutes from Alhambra and surrounding communities.

Camp serves youth groups affiliated with the West San Gabriel Valley YMCA and also available to youth, church, school groups, family reunions, and retreats. Camp also lend's itself as a great location for business retreats and team building activities.

Camp Ta Ta Pochon offers great food at an affordable price in a spacious dining hall, a beautiful mountain setting with a creek running thru the 13+ acres, many recreational and outdoor activities (depending on the time of year), hiking, bike trials, access to beautiful Jenks Lake, and rustic cabins that sleep from 10 - 12 persons.

Teen Wilderness Adventure Camp, Age 13-16

( Beginners Backpacking Program )

August 18 - August 25, 2007 (Sat.to Sat.)

Cost: $285

Includes food & transportation

Our adventure begins at camp as we learn group decision making skills

at our low-ropes course.  Teens will be taught how to use and maintain basic equipment, orienteering, cooking in the out-of-doors, and basic safety tips.  We'll spend 2.5 dsys exploring the San Gorgonio Wilderness learning basic backpacking skills including : low-impact camping, and trail navigation. All teens will carry their own equipment; and will share community tasks like cooking and cleaning. Swimming, hiking, canoeing, archery, air-rifles (BB guns), climbing wall, ropes course, art & crafts, sports games, dance, & campfire. Trip will be lead by staff trained in outdoor skills and wilderness first-aid.
